Bright lights, bright Wolverine
Hugh Jackman wants to sing and dance some more By Patrick Sauriol

Wolverine is now a producer.
In an article printed inside today's
Variety,
X-MEN star Hugh Jackman has signed a deal to create musical films for Walt Disney Pictures. Jackman and John Palermo, who was Bryan Singer's assistant on the two
X-MEN films, have created their own producing company to bring about these films. Joining them on the Disney projects will be Craig Nadan and Neil Meron, executive producers of
CHICAGO and are working on the musical version of
HAIRSPRAY.
Disney could be making as many as three musicals for Jackman and his producing partners, which the
X-MEN star hopes are all original works (although a remake or two could be in the cards.) As he is an experienced professional when it comes to the stage, Jackman may also star in the films.
Variety also revealed an interesting and previously unrevealed fact about the
X-MEN 3 and
WOLVERINE films in development at 20th Century Fox: Jackman and Palermo will be involved in both films as producers.
